I start my chevy truck and the red shifter indicator does not light up. When this happens I loose my tack and speedometer. The trans will not shift and starts out in drive. I am able to manually shift starting in low. It started out about a year ago but seemed to correct its self. Now it occures about every other time I start the truck. If I continue to turn the key on and off with out engaging the starter some times the shifter light comes on. The key here is if the shifter indicator is lite everything works fine.
Can you tell me where to start looking?
